Golden Cage - Camilla Läckberg

No, just no.

I was really excited I could read The Golden Cage through Pigeonhole. I have been a big fan of the Fjallbacka series for years (though admittedly, the last book is still waiting for me to read it). So, I was expecting a great read during these COVID-19 times, but I was very disappointed.

The Golden Cage is a 180-turn of the other books by Camilla Lackberg, in that it is not cozy at all. Instead it is filled with bad sex, bad power plays, and ridiculous schemes (one even more implausible than the other). There are so many easy coincidences that my eyes started to hurt from all the rolling they had to do. Fjallbacka is mentioned a couple of times, but all that was good about her books were clearly left back in Fjallbacka.

I do not think I will read more of her standalone books.
